      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hey Guys,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I was wondering if a 1220 AP (AIR-AP1220-A-K9) is capable of converting to lightweight mode. The AP does B Radio only (AIR-MP20B-A-K9). On the Cisco site it says that B-Only Radio is not capable of converting to ligthweight. I just need a confirmation if this is true or not? Thanks.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i Tyler,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Sadly this is correct.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The 1200 Series can be upgraded to LWAPP with the G Radio model listed below; &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Solution Requirements &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Migration from autonomous access point mode to lightweight mode is possible on these Cisco Aironet access point platforms: &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;All 1130AG access points &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;All 1240 AG access points &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;For all IOS-based 1200 series modular access points (**1200/1220 Cisco IOS Software Upgrade, 1210 and 1230 AP) platforms, it depends on the radio: &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;if 802.11G, MP21G and MP31G are supported &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;if 802.11A, RM21A and RM22A are supported &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The 1200 series access points can be upgraded with any combination of supported radios: G only, A only, or both G and A. &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;From this good doc; &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;A class="jive-link-custom" href="http://www.cisco.com/en/US/products/hw/wireless/ps430/prod_technical_reference09186a00804fc3dc.html" target="_blank"&gt;http://www.cisco.com/en/US/products/hw/wireless/ps430/prod_technical_reference09186a00804fc3dc.html&lt;/A&gt; &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hope this helps! &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Rob &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
